    D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ES FOR THE FIELD ENGINEER:

    1. With guidance from the project Railway Signal Engineer, develop work plans for railway signal locations using wiring diagrams, construction drawings and specifications to identify the tasks to be completed at each location.

    2. The work plan at a minimum shall include:

      • Materials needed for work to be completed at each railway signal location
      • Wiring changes that must be completed at each railway signal location
      • Equipment to be installed or removed at each railway signal location
      • Tests to be completed at each railway signal location
    3. Create checklists of work to be verified as complete for each railway signal location.

    4. Use checklists to witness and validate railway signal work completed by field forces on-site.

    5. Maintain and keep current a journal of daily work activities.

    6. Prepare daily activity report of work progressed and completed at each work location.

    7. Obtain and deliver time-sensitive wiring diagrams, test documents and materials to the job site.

    8. Scan images of test datasheets and wiring diagrams to upload to document management system

    9. Update the document management system (Procore and BOX).

    10. Compile, track, and analyze project information and generate reports.

    11. Keep track of materials on-hand and identify materials needed to keep work moving.

    12. Assist the project manager as needed.
